Atlas Energy Solutions Inc. (NYSE: AESI) is a leading solutions provider to the energy industry. Atlas’ portfolio of offerings includes oilfield logistics, distributed power systems, and the largest proppant supply network in the Permian Basin. With a focus on leveraging technology, automation, and remote operations to enhance efficiencies, Atlas is centered around a core mission of improving human beings’ access to hydrocarbons that power our lives and, by doing so, maximizing value creation for our shareholders.

How You Will Make an Impact

The Reliability / Maintenance Engineering Intern will support the maintenance and reliability teams in improving overall asset reliability and optimizing preventative maintenance (PM) programs. This role is ideal for students interested in maintenance engineering, reliability engineering, or industrial operations. You’ll be directly involved in analyzing equipment failures, improving PM standards, and supporting backlog cleanup to help strengthen Atlas Energy’s long‑term maintenance strategy.

Key Responsibilities

• Optimize and refine preventative maintenance (PM) tasks to improve efficiency and asset performance

• Track and analyze repeat equipment failures to identify root causes and patterns

• Support maintenance backlog cleanup, including work order review and prioritization

• Conduct MTBF (Mean Time Between Failures) and MTTR (Mean Time to Repair) analysis to support reliability decisions

• Collaborate with maintenance technicians and reliability engineers to validate findings and improvement opportunities

• Assist in standardizing reliability practices across Atlas Energy assets and locations

Expected Deliverables

• Optimized PM Library: Updated, streamlined PM tasks aligned with reliability best practices

• Top 10 Failure Analysis: Insights into recurring failures, root causes, and recommended mitigations

• Spares Criticality List: Prioritized spare parts ranking to support maintenance planning and inventory management
